Background
The shared charging treasure is charging treasure leasing equipment released by an enterprise on-line place, a user becomes a registered user by paying a deposit or avoiding the deposit by means of a designated credit value, and then the user can fast borrow the charging treasure or connect a charging interface to obtain charging service by paying a certain amount of money, wherein the mobile charging treasure needs to return to a nearby cabinet after the use.

The top of the back of the cabinet shell 1 is provided with a plurality of heat dissipation holes 3, the outer surface of the installation sleeve 4 is uniformly provided with heat dissipation through holes, and the heat dissipation through holes are communicated with the inside of the installation sleeve 4; the design is beneficial to the heat dissipation in the installation sleeve 4.
The tact key switch 8 is electrically connected with the liquid cooling radiator 5.
When the utility model is used (working principle), when a user inserts the charger baby into the inner cavity of the charger baby placing frame 2 from the top of the charger baby placing frame 2, the side of the charger baby can effectively apply an extrusion force to the pressing plate 11, and the side of the charger baby can be attached to the liquid inlet pipe 501 and the liquid outlet pipe 502 when the charger baby enters the mounting sleeve 4, meanwhile, the sliding rod 10 moves to one side close to the light touch key switch 8, when the pressing plate 11 enters the slot 9, the sliding rod 10 can apply an extrusion force to the light touch key switch 8, and the liquid cooling radiator 5 corresponding to the bottom of the charger baby placing frame 2 is started through the light touch key switch 8, after the liquid cooling radiator 5 is started, the liquid outlet pipe 502 and the liquid inlet pipe 501 connected on the liquid cooling radiator 5 can be utilized to radiate the charger baby inside the mounting sleeve 4, after the charger baby inside the mounting sleeve 4 is taken out from the charger baby placing frame 2, because the pressing plate 11 loses the extrusion of the charger baby, the sliding rod 10 can be pushed back by the spring 13 and reset, and finally the sliding rod 10 does not press the touch key switch 8 any more, so that the power-off of the liquid cooling radiator 5 is realized.
